Synopsis
Mystery and intrigue haunt the new land shortly after the successful Revolutionary War. New problems arise as the land settles into a long journey westward.Historical fiction with mystery and romance, set in 1792. The unlikely combination of witchcraft and high treason lead to treachery and murder haunting a hero's daughter and the soldier she loves. Vanishings in a growing Kentucky town spark fears of government conspiracies combined with the supernatural. An experiment in tolerance and unprecedented freedom for women unexpectedly yields chaos, attracting evil in a way no one predicted. Named at birth by her dying mother in hopes she would be a light in the world, daughter of a heroic general, and only 17, Lantern Leshoward finds herself at the center of excitement as her town prepares an elaborate celebration in the midst of a string of disappearances of young women. The post war generation faces unique challenges neglected by their elders who are preoccupied with politics and social status. Upper and lower class women disappear but their fates are secondary to an upcoming political masquerade gala, diverting everyone's attention from the ongoing crimes, whether or not they are products of the dark arts. Complicating this is an openly labeled witch no one can find with a strange hold over Lantern's father. Lantern's admirer, Shears Plate, a skeptical soldier with a detective's mind, suspects common criminality but he is shocked when he confronts spies involved in animal sacrifices that lead to political assassinations. His unlikely assistants in his quest for the truth include Lantern's mysterious cousin Genevieve, reappearing after years of subterfuge, an abandoned slave who lives in the forest, and a solitary sword maker whose products have a fame transcending borders. Then a strange beautiful woman arrives as his betrothed, despite their never before having met and it becomes harder than ever to distinguish the good from the bad. Plate must plan an elaborately staged killing, risking prominent victims, to expose those invoking the evil art of murder to undermine the new republic. Great for Young Adults
